"The singularity" is a term that any science-fiction fan and/or computer scientist will have heard. I will confess that the definition and implications of it weren't that clear to me before starting this book. Shanahan does a very good job at defining it, considering how artificial general intelligence could possibly be achieved, how it can lead to singularity, and what could be the impact of this, considering both technical and philosophical questions, at a very accessible and pretty engaging level. A thoroughly interesting read - although it definitely adds to the general sense of World Anxiety instead of alleviating it ;)
